The City of Richmond lies on the eastern shore of San Francisco Bay, five miles north of Berkeley and seven miles northeast across the Bay from downtown San Francisco. A hub of multimodal transportation, many of our residents and businesses are located in Richmond because of its central location and easy access to the Amtrak/Capitol Corridor, BART, AC Transit, the ferry, and two freeways (I-80 & I-580). Residents, visitors, and employees enjoy Richmond’s numerous recreational opportunities, which include 32 miles of shoreline and over 3,000 acres of shoreline parks, more segments of the Bay Trail completed than any other city, several recreational boat harbors and yacht clubs, and thousands of acres of contiguous inland regional parks and open space. CLASS CHARACTERISTICS
Code Enforcement Officer I – This is the entry-level class in the code compliance series. Positions assigned to this class perform the more routine and standardized tasks. Assignments are performed within the procedural framework established by higher-level employees. However, as experience is acquired, the incumbent will perform tasks of increasing responsibility. Promotion to Code Enforcement Officer II shall be by departmental review and examination.
Code Enforcement Officer II – This is the journey-level class, and incumbents at this level receive only occasional instruction or assistance as new or unusual situations arise, and are fully aware of the operating procedures and policies of the work unit.
Vacancies may be filled as a Code Enforcement Officer I or Code Enforcement Officer II.
Position Description and Duties
Depending upon assignment, duties may include, but are not limited to, the following:
Conducts field checks to uncover possible violations of a variety of City codes and ordinances, including zoning, nuisance, property maintenance and housing.- Investigates possible violations; contacts responsible individuals in person and in writing; performs follow-up investigations to see that remedial action has been taken and to insure compliance.
- Works closely with homeowners, businesses and community groups to enhance and preserve the quality of neighborhoods through public relations, educational and code enforcement activities.
- Coordinates inspections and dispositions of cases with various City departments, including police and fire, county agencies and other local agencies, including utilities.
- Responds to citizen complaints regarding code violations; exercises appropriate judgment in prioritizing calls; investigates and resolves problems and provides information to public by phone and in person regarding code regulations.
- Assists in determining appropriate disposition of outstanding cases after consulting with the City Attorney, building and planning personnel; assists the City Attorney's office in preparing cases for court action; issues citations for infractions as provided by the Municipal Code.
- Routinely prepares reports, recommendations and correspondence; some requiring lengthy research.
- Organizes and maintains manual and computerized records of investigations, hearings and related activities.
- Inputs and retrieves a variety of information using a computer terminal.
- Analyzes and makes recommendations on policy development.

Cultivation Technician
Be Kind Production is a high-growth California cannabis company known for high quality craft cannabis products.
We are seeking individuals who are passionate about making a difference in the work they do and will help support the growth of our company. We are looking for candidates that will embrace the challenge of working in an ever-changing market. Great work ethic and flexibility are a must for this job.
Technicians are responsible for executing production plans in keeping with the Company’s operating procedures for indoor cannabis cultivation. Technicians carry out the day-to-day assignments and tasks of the cannabis production cycle. Company operates under the highest standards of compliance.
Responsibilities:
- Works with VP of Cultivation to plan for growing activities that are consistent with planned production schedules.
- Prepares space required for planned production.
- Cloning: cutting, rooting, and transplanting; clone care, watering and feeding; clone monitoring and climate control; labeling; and inventory data input into state mandated electronic tracking system.
- Monitors growing conditions and reviews changes in humidity, moisture and temperature and cultivation procedures to ensure conformance with quality control standards.
- Inspects crop to ascertain conditions such as leaf texture, bloom size and the existence of pests or disease; removing substandard or diseased plants to maintain quality standards.
- Plant monitoring and care during vegetative and flowering phase: trimming and staking; big leafing and pruning; plant care, watering and feeding; plant monitoring and climate control; pest and disease control; inventory data input.
- Harvesting: cutting plants; trimming cut plants; removing flowering tops; weighing and inventory data input into the electronic inventory tracking system.
- Curing: hanging and dry-racking flowers; monitoring curing process and climate control; labeling; weighing and inventory data input.
- Preparation and packaging of all cannabis products will be needed during peak times, including extraction products.
- Operating and maintaining cultivation systems/equipment: monitoring, calibrating, running, and maintaining lighting, irrigation, climate control and other cultivation systems; stocking and handling production inputs and supplies; sanitizing and cleaning growing areas, cultivation workspaces and tools.
- Ensure daily compliance with policies and procedures including but not limited to, state compliance, security protocols, and access protocols.

Vital Farms is a Certified B Corp that sources and markets delicious, high-quality, ethically-sourced egg and dairy products nationwide. We started on a single family-farm in Austin, TX in 2007, with 20 Rhode Island hens and a drive to raise the standards in sustainable agriculture. Today Vital Farms is THE leading producer of pasture raised eggs, partnering with more than 200 family farms, and selling into over 13,000 grocery stores around the country.
